When choosing, favor tools that engage the mouthparts rather than the body and those that avoid compressing the abdomen. Use slow, steady traction or controlled rotation instead of jerking; this lowers the chance of crushing the tick and releasing fluids. If you encounter different life stages, select a tool with multiple hook sizes or interchangeable tips so you can match tick size and fur thickness, maximizing intact removal and minimizing infection risk.

Tool Material Durability

Consider the construction and materials of a tick remover as you shop, since what it’s made from determines how long it stays safe and effective; stainless steel and high-strength aluminum stand up better to repeated use and sterilization than most plastics or thin plated metals, which can crack, corrode, or deform under torque, heat, or UV exposure. Choose stainless steel if you want maximum corrosion resistance and repeated sterilization—its edges hold up and it won’t warp. High-strength aluminum gives a lighter option but may bend under heavy leverage. Avoid thin stamped or plated parts and brittle molded plastics that develop cracks or lose shape. Inspect joints, seams, and cutting edges for burrs, and pick tools whose materials maintain form after cleaning to guarantee safe long-term performance.

Safety For Pets And Humans

Because removing a tick quickly and correctly cuts the chance of disease transmission and skin injury, pick a tool that slides or leverages the tick’s mouthparts out rather than squeezing its body; that method minimizes pathogen transfer and reduces trauma for both pets and people. You’ll want a design that gives precise control near sensitive skin—slim, non-slip handles and a narrow tip help you work around ears, eyes, and fur without crushing the tick. Choose corrosion-resistant materials you can disinfect, and prefer tools that let you keep the removed specimen intact for identification or testing. Make sure the tool is comfortable for you to use on a wriggling pet or an anxious person, so you can act calmly and remove ticks promptly and safely.

Can Tick Removal Tools Spread Tick-Borne Diseases Between Uses?

Yes — if you reuse an unclean tick remover, you can transfer pathogens between uses. You should clean or disinfect the tool after every use, ideally with alcohol, bleach solution, or boiling where appropriate, and avoid touching the tick’s body. If you can, use single-use disposable tools or carry multiple removers. Always wash hands thoroughly and monitor bite sites for signs of infection, seeking medical advice if symptoms appear.

How Long Can I Safely Keep a Removed Tick for Testing?

You can safely keep a removed tick for testing for up to 2–4 weeks if you store it properly. Place the tick in a sealed container or vial with a damp paper towel or cotton ball to maintain humidity, label it with the date and location, and refrigerate (not freeze) at 4°C if possible. Send it to a lab or public health office promptly; longer storage reduces viability for some tests.

Can Tick Remover Tools Damage the Tick and Increase Infection Risk?

Yes — if you squeeze, twist roughly, or use heat/chemicals, you can crush the tick and push infected fluids into the bite. You should use a proper remover or fine-tipped tweezers, grasping the tick close to the skin and pulling straight out with steady, even pressure. Don’t squeeze the body. After removal, clean the area, wash hands, and monitor for redness or symptoms; seek medical advice if concerned.
